英文摘要Germination capacity of alfalfa seeds under low energy N^+ implantation manifests oscillations going down with dose strength. From analyzing alfalfa genome DNA under low energy N~ implantation by RAPD (Random Amplified Polymorphous DNA), it is recommended that 30 polymorphic DNA fragments be amplified with 8 primers in total 100 primers, and fluorescence intensity of the identical DNA fragments amplified by RAPD is different between CK and treatments. Number of different polymorphic DNA fragments between treatment and CK via N+ implantation manifests going up with dose strength.
